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using an incorrect blade type for brass, leading to rough cuts and excessive heat.Employ a blade specifically designed for non-ferrous metals, such as a fine-toothed carbide-tipped blade, and always use a lubricant or coolant.
Inadequate securing of the material, resulting in vibration and imprecise cuts.Secure the brass stock sheet firmly to the workbench or cutting platform, ensuring it is stable and free from movement during the sawing process.
